From 4bca68756fa9fa21ca02711405768de8a4ab63cc Mon Sep 17 00:00:00 2001 From: Alin Voinea Date: Fri, 2 Oct 2020 18:46:03 +0300 Subject: [PATCH] Refs #1001 - Make tests more generic --- news/1001.bugfix | 2 ++ src/plone/restapi/tests/test_services_types.py | 14 ++++++++------ 2 files changed, 10 insertions(+), 6 deletions(-) create mode 100644 news/1001.bugfix diff --git a/news/1001.bugfix b/news/1001.bugfix new file mode 100644 index 0000000000..bbbe4935ee --- /dev/null +++ b/news/1001.bugfix @@ -0,0 +1,2 @@ +- Update tests to fix https://github.com/plone/plone.dexterity/pull/137 +[@avoinea] diff --git a/src/plone/restapi/tests/test_services_types.py b/src/plone/restapi/tests/test_services_types.py index 75c13383d4..040204f996 100644 --- a/src/plone/restapi/tests/test_services_types.py +++ b/src/plone/restapi/tests/test_services_types.py @@ -132,9 +132,10 @@ def test_types_document_get_field(self): self.assertEqual( "Email of the author", response.json().get("description") ) # noqa - self.assertEqual( - "plone.dexterity.schema.generated.plone_0_Document", - response.json().get("behavior"), + self.assertTrue( + response.json() + .get("behavior") + .startswith("plone.dexterity.schema.generated.plone_") ) # noqa self.assertEqual("string", response.json().get("type")) self.assertEqual("email", response.json().get("widget")) @@ -169,9 +170,10 @@ def test_types_document_post_field(self): self.assertEqual(response.status_code, 201) self.assertEqual("Email", response.json().get("title")) self.assertEqual("Foo bar email", response.json().get("description")) - self.assertEqual( - "plone.dexterity.schema.generated.plone_0_Document", - response.json().get("behavior"), + self.assertTrue( + response.json() + .get("behavior") + .startswith("plone.dexterity.schema.generated.plone_") ) # noqa self.assertEqual("string", response.json().get("type")) self.assertEqual("email", response.json().get("widget"))